Best Ways to Protect Your Simulator Hardware from Dust and Environmental Damage

Simulator hardware is a valuable investment for training, entertainment, and research. However, it is vulnerable to dust, moisture, and environmental factors that can cause damage or reduce performance. Protecting your simulator hardware is essential to ensure longevity and optimal operation.

Understanding the Risks

Dust accumulation can clog vents and fans, leading to overheating and hardware failure. Moisture from humidity or spills can cause corrosion and short circuits. Temperature fluctuations and direct sunlight can also degrade components over time. Recognizing these risks helps in implementing effective protective measures.

Effective Protective Measures

1. Use Dust Covers

Cover your simulator when not in use with dust-resistant covers. These covers prevent dust from settling on sensitive components while allowing airflow to prevent overheating.

2. Maintain a Controlled Environment

Place your simulator in a clean, dry, and temperature-controlled room. Use air conditioning or dehumidifiers to maintain optimal humidity levels and reduce the risk of moisture damage.

3. Regular Cleaning and Maintenance

Clean your hardware regularly with compressed air to remove dust from vents and fans. Avoid using liquids or abrasive cleaners that could damage components. Schedule periodic inspections to identify and address potential issues early.

Additional Tips

  • Ensure proper ventilation around the hardware.
  • Keep liquids away from the simulator.
  • Use surge protectors to guard against electrical damage.
  • Position the simulator away from direct sunlight and heat sources.

By implementing these protective strategies, you can extend the lifespan of your simulator hardware and maintain its performance. Regular care and environmental control are key to safeguarding your investment against dust and environmental damage.
